Jun Arima is Chief Sustainability Officer, Japan Organization of Metal and Energy Security (JOGMEC) and Visiting Professor, Graduate School of Public Policy, University of Tokyo. He also serves as, Consulting Fellow at the Research Institute of Economy, Economy, Trade and Industry (RIETI), Distinguished Senior Research Fellow at the Asia Pacific Institute of Research (APIR), and Senior Policy Fellow for Energy and Environment at the Economic Research Institute for ASEAN and East Asia (ERIA). He was a Lead Author of the Intergovernmental Panel of Climate Change (IPCC) 6th Assessment Report. His publication includes “Energy Policies of the IEA Countries” (2003-2006 editions), “Memoir of the Kyoto Protocol” (2014), “Truth of Global Warming Negotiation – Economic War on National Interests-“(2015), “Global Warming Countermeasures with Pragmatism – Paris Agreement and Thereafter” (2016), “Trump Risk – America First and Global Warming” (2017), “Policy Recommendations by the Quadripartite Commission on the Indian Ocean Regional Security” (Chapter 2) (2017), “Japan’s Energy Conundrum” (Chapter 11) (2018), “Finding a Viable Path for Reducing GHG Emissions2 (2019 King Abdullah Petroleum Studies and Research Center (KAPSARC), “Eco-fundamentalism as a Grist to China’s Mill” (2021), “Eco-fundamentalism will ruin our country” (2021), and “Eco-Fascism –Diseases calling for Decarbonization, Renewables and Nuclear Phase-out” (2022 Joint Authorship).

Energy sovereignty in an interconnected world: aligning national priorities, markets and global security

Energy sovereignty is now a core policy priority, but no country can fully insulate itself from global energy markets, technology systems, capital flows or supply chain shocks. The central question is not whether nations can eliminate dependency, but how they identify and manage the dependencies that matter most. Governments are reassessing exposure across fuels, minerals, processing capacity, grid equipment and digital systems, each with different security implications and mitigation costs. China holds around 80% of global solar manufacturing capacity and roughly 75% of battery production; 11 of the 20 minerals critical to the energy transition faced export controls at some point in 2025, demonstrating how dependencies can become instruments of geopolitical leverage. Europe's experience with Russian energy reinforces that resilience must be weighed against affordability and competitiveness. The countries that govern dependency with clarity, rather than react in crisis, will be better placed to protect energy security while remaining connected to global capital and innovation.
